Navigating Licensing and Regulatory Differences

The licensing regimes for these casinos can vary widely, from Malta’s MGA to the Curacao eGaming authority, and others that may be less familiar to the average player. Each regulator imposes different standards—some stringent, others more lenient. For example, while MGA-licensed casinos often maintain solid player protection rules, those under less recognized jurisdictions may offer fewer guarantees when it comes to fairness or dispute resolution.

It’s important to remember that the UKGC is known for its strict requirements, including protections against problem gambling and ensuring fair play through RTP (Return to Player) audits. Non UKGC casinos might advertise RTPs hovering around 96.5% or higher for popular titles like NetEnt’s Starburst, but without the UK’s regular audits, players must rely on the platform’s transparency and reputation.

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them

Entering the world of non UKGC casinos can feel a bit like wandering into uncharted territory without a map. Common issues include unclear bonus terms, slower withdrawals, or restricted player support. Misunderstandings about wagering requirements on bonuses are frequent—these might be much higher than what you’re used to under UKGC rules.

From my experience, a few simple precautions can make a significant difference:

  1. Always read the full terms and conditions before signing up or depositing.
  2. Stick to well-known software providers like Evolution or Play’n GO, as their games usually have transparent RTPs.
  3. Check the casino’s payment options carefully; avoid sites that limit withdrawals to unusual methods or impose heavy fees.
  4. Look for casinos that display clear licensing information and have established player support channels.
  5. Trust your gut—if something feels off about a site, it probably is.

These steps won’t eliminate all risks, but they help keep the experience enjoyable rather than stressful.

The Role of Technology and Payment Options

Many non UKGC casinos embrace newer payment technologies to set themselves apart. For instance, some accept instant bank transfers like BankID or digital wallets not widely available in UK-regulated sites. While this can offer convenience, it also introduces a layer of complexity in tracking transactions and ensuring security.

SSL encryption remains a must-have for any reputable casino, and most non UKGC casinos are aware of this necessity. Still, players should verify the presence of basic security features before trusting a site with personal and financial data.

Technology also influences game fairness and randomness. Providers like NetEnt and Evolution employ sophisticated algorithms tested for integrity, but when games are sourced from less transparent developers, it’s harder to evaluate reliability. This uncertainty is part of the gamble when stepping outside the UKGC framework.
